Who was the Governor of Nebraska in 1955?

Robert B. Crosby (born March 26, 1911 in North Platte, Nebraska; died January 7, 2000 in Lincoln, Nebraska) succeeded Val Peterson as the twenty-seventh Governor of Nebraska, serving between January 8, 1953 and January 6, 1955. Following the end of Crosby's term as Governor, Victor Emanuel Anderson (born March 30, 1903 in Havelock, Nebraska; died August 15, 1962) became the twenty-eighth Governor of Nebraska, serving between January 6, 1955 and January 8, 1959.

Who was the Governor of Nebraska in 1953?

Val Peterson (born Frederick Valdemar Erastus Peterson on July 18, 1903 in Oakland, Nebraska; died October 17, 1983 in Fremont, Nebraska) succeeded Dwight Griswold as the twenty-sixth Governor of Nebraska, serving between January 9, 1947 and January 8, 1953. Following the end of Peterson's term as Governor, Robert B. Crosby (born March 26, 1911 in North Platte, Nebraska; died January 7, 2000 in Lincoln, Nebraska) became the twenty-seventh Governor of Nebraska, serving between January 8, 1953 and January 6, 1955.
